Roles covered in this chart include: 1. **Human Rights Officer**: These professionals contribute to safeguarding the rights and liberties of individuals in various settings. Typical tasks involve conducting investigations, reporting findings, and organizing advocacy initiatives. 2. **Policy Analyst**: Policy analysts research and evaluate policies to provide recommendations for improvement or creation. They collaborate with stakeholders to ensure policies align with organizational goals and societal needs. 3. **Legal Advisor**: Legal advisors counsel organizations on legal matters, ensuring compliance with relevant laws and regulations. They may also represent their clients in negotiations, disputes, or administrative hearings. 4. **Compliance Officer**: Compliance officers ensure adherence to laws, regulations, and guidelines within their organization. They monitor activities, develop internal policies, and provide guidance to minimize risks and avoid legal issues. 5. **International Lawyer**: International lawyers practice law related to international trade, commerce, and human rights. They may represent clients in international courts or negotiations and help businesses navigate foreign legal systems.
